ABSTRACT:
An electrical heater cable is positioned within an assembly of multiple junction thermocouple cables associated with the elongated gamma heated body of a local power measuring unit to electrically heat the body from an external source during a calibration period. The signal outputs of the thermocouples are measured during the calibration period for steady state analysis of the signal response to changes in heating rate produced either by additional electrical heating, by abrupt termination of electrical heating or by supply of sinusoidally varied heating current to the heater cable.
